⭐ Core Definition: Southern Alps

The Southern Alps (Māori: Kā Tiritiri o te Moana; officially Southern Alps / Kā Tiritiri o te Moana) are a mountain range extending along much of the length of New Zealand's South Island, reaching its greatest elevations near the range's western side. The name "Southern Alps" generally refers to the entire range, although separate names are given to many of the smaller ranges that form part of it.

The range includes the South Island's Main Divide, which separates the water catchments of the more heavily populated eastern side of the island from those on the west coast. Politically, the Main Divide forms the boundary between the Marlborough, Canterbury and Otago regions to the southeast and the Tasman and West Coast regions to the northwest.

Southern Alps in the context of New Zealand

New Zealand is an island country in the southwestern Pacific Ocean. It consists of two main landmasses—the North Island (Te Ika-a-Māui) and the South Island (Te Waipounamu)—and over 600 smaller islands. It is the sixth-largest island country by area and lies east of Australia across the Tasman Sea and south of the islands of New Caledonia, Fiji, and Tonga. The country's varied topography and sharp mountain peaks, including the Southern Alps (Kā Tiritiri o te Moana), owe much to tectonic uplift and volcanic eruptions. New Zealand's capital city is Wellington, and its most populous city is Auckland.

The islands of New Zealand were the last large habitable land to be settled by humans. Between about 1280 and 1350, Polynesians began to settle in the islands and subsequently developed a distinctive Māori culture. In 1642, the Dutch explorer Abel Tasman became the first European to sight and record New Zealand. In 1769 the British explorer Captain James Cook became the first European to set foot on and map New Zealand. In 1840, representatives of the United Kingdom and Māori chiefs signed the Treaty of Waitangi, which paved the way for Britain's declaration of sovereignty later that year and the establishment of the Crown Colony of New Zealand in 1841. Subsequently, a series of conflicts between the colonial government and Māori tribes resulted in the alienation and confiscation of large amounts of Māori land. New Zealand became a dominion in 1907; it gained full statutory independence in 1947, retaining the monarch as head of state. Today, the majority of New Zealand's population of around 5.3 million is of European descent; the indigenous Māori are the largest minority, followed by Asians and Pasifika. Reflecting this, New Zealand's culture mainly derives from Māori and early British settlers but has recently broadened from increased immigration. The official languages are English, Māori, and New Zealand Sign Language, with the local dialect of English being dominant.

Southern Alps in the context of Terrain

Terrain (from Latin terra 'earth'), alternatively relief or topographical relief, is the dimension and shape of a given surface of a land. In physical geography, terrain is the lay of the land. This is usually expressed in terms of the elevation, slope, and orientation of terrain features. Terrain affects surface water flow and distribution. Over a large area, it can affect weather and climate patterns. Bathymetry is the study of underwater relief, while hypsometry studies terrain relative to sea level.

Southern Alps in the context of Permafrost

Permafrost (from perma- 'permanent' and frost) is soil or underwater sediment which continuously remains below 0 °C (32 °F) for two years or more; the oldest permafrost has been continuously frozen for around 700,000 years. Whilst the shallowest permafrost has a vertical extent of below a meter (3 ft), the deepest is greater than 1,500 m (4,900 ft). Similarly, the area of individual permafrost zones may be limited to narrow mountain summits or extend across vast Arctic regions. The ground beneath glaciers and ice sheets is not usually defined as permafrost, so on land, permafrost is generally located beneath a so-called active layer of soil which freezes and thaws depending on the season.

Around 15% of the Northern Hemisphere or 11% of the global surface is underlain by permafrost, covering a total area of around 18 million km (6.9 million sq mi). This includes large areas of Alaska, Canada, Greenland, and Siberia. It is also located in high mountain regions, with the Tibetan Plateau being a prominent example. Only a minority of permafrost exists in the Southern Hemisphere, where it is consigned to mountain slopes like in the Andes of Patagonia, the Southern Alps of New Zealand, or the highest mountains of Antarctica.

Southern Alps in the context of Geography of New Zealand

New Zealand (Māori: Aotearoa) is an island country located in the southwestern Pacific Ocean, near the centre of the water hemisphere. It consists of a large number of islands, estimated around 700, mainly remnants of a larger landmass now beneath the sea. The land masses by size are the South Island (Te Waipounamu) and the North Island (Te Ika-a-Māui), separated by the Cook Strait. The third-largest is Stewart Island (Rakiura), located 30 kilometres (19 miles) off the tip of the South Island across Foveaux Strait. Other islands are significantly smaller in area. The three largest islands stretch 1,600 kilometres (990 miles) across latitudes 35° to 47° south. New Zealand is the sixth-largest island country in the world, with a land size of 268,680 km (103,740 sq mi).

New Zealand's landscapes range from the fiord-like sounds of the southwest to the sandy beaches of the subtropical Far North. The South Island is dominated by the Southern Alps while a volcanic plateau covers much of the central North Island. Temperatures commonly fall below 0 °C (32 °F) and rise above 30 °C (86 °F) then conditions vary from wet and cold on the South Island's west coast to dry and continental a short distance away across the mountains and to the tundra like climate in the Deep South of Southland.

Southern Alps in the context of Alpine Fault

The Alpine Fault is a geological fault that runs almost the entire length of New Zealand's South Island, being about 600 km (370 mi). long, and forms the boundary between the Pacific plate and the Australian plate. The Southern Alps have been uplifted on the fault over the last 12 million years in a series of earthquakes. However, most of the motion on the fault is strike-slip (side to side), with the Tasman district and West Coast moving north and Canterbury and Otago moving south. The average slip rates in the fault's central region are about 38 mm (1.5 in) a year, very fast by global standards. The last major earthquake on the Alpine Fault was in about 1717 AD with a great earthquake magnitude of Mw8.1± 0.1. The probability of another one occurring before 2068 was estimated at 75 percent in 2021.

Southern Alps in the context of Waimakariri River

The Waimakariri River is one of the largest rivers in Canterbury, on the eastern coast of New Zealand's South Island. It flows for 151 kilometres (94 mi) in a generally southeastward direction from the Southern Alps across the Canterbury Plains to the Pacific Ocean.

The river rises on the eastern flanks of the Southern Alps, eight kilometres southwest of Arthur's Pass. For much of its upper reaches, the river is braided, with wide shingle beds. As the river approaches the Canterbury Plains, it passes through a belt of mountains, and is forced into a narrow canyon (the Waimakariri Gorge), before reverting to its braided form for its passage across the plains. It enters the Pacific north of Christchurch, near the town of Kaiapoi.

Southern Alps in the context of Aoraki / Mount Cook

Aoraki / Mount Cook is the highest mountain in New Zealand. Its height, as of 2014, is listed as 3,724 metres (12,218 feet). It is situated in the Southern Alps, the mountain range that runs the length of the South Island. A popular tourist destination, it is also a favourite challenge for mountaineers. Aoraki / Mount Cook consists of three summits: from south to north, the Low Peak (3,593 m or 11,788 ft), the Middle Peak (3,717 m or 12,195 ft) and the High Peak. The summits lie slightly south and east of the main divide of the Southern Alps, with the Tasman Glacier to the east and the Hooker Glacier to the southwest. Mount Cook is ranked 10th in the world by topographic isolation.
